Formular Eingaben verändern und weitergeben?

08/09/2013 16:10 DasPrinzip.#1
Hallo com,

jetzt habe ich noch eine Frage.

Wenn jemand z.B. in ein Formular eingibt: [Only registered and activated users can see links. Click Here To Register...]
Kann PHP diesen Link bevor er es in die Datenbank einträgt verändern in z.B.

//www.muster.de/m/22312

Dabei geht es um Youtube. Man gibt den Link ein
Code:
http://www.youtube.com/watch?v=kAsDxcE
, aber dieser soll in //www.youtube.com/embed/kAsDxcE umgewandelt werden und so in die Datenbank eingetragen werden.

Danke.
08/09/2013 17:15 Mikesch01#2
Und wo ist die Frage? Willst du das wir dir das machen oder willst du wissen wie sowas gemacht wird?
08/09/2013 17:39 'Aleo#3
Also ich würde den wichtigen teil nach dem = raussplitten und dann einfach in einem neuen string zusammenfassen.
08/09/2013 17:46 DasPrinzip.#4
Mit splitten hab ich mich noch nie beschäftigt. Hab auch ehrlich gesagt nicht die zeit dazu.
Eine kleine Erklärung wäre nett.
Sonst Grabe ich mich durch die Foren wenn ich hier so hilfsbereite und freundliche Menschen antreffe.
D.h. Mit Explode ?

PHP Code:
$eingabe $_Post['link'];

$wert explode("="$eingabe); 
Und $wert muss dann in die Datenbank eingetragen werden? Heist das ist dann der letzte Part vom link?
08/09/2013 18:31 Mozo_#5
PHP Code:
$eingabe $_Post['link'];

$wert explode("="$eingabe); 

$link '//www.youtube.com/embed/'.$wert[1]; 
dabei sollte $wert dann "//www.youtube.com/embed/kAsDxcE" sein.